We don't know the exact largest number of moves required to solve any solvable configuration of a Rubik's Cube-like puzzle in higher dimensions.

open Global / Unspecified, Global

While the standard cube's maximum was determined through massive computation, generalized versions with more dimensions or larger sizes remain computationally and theoretically unresolved. This connects group theory with combinatorial optimization.
